"With just a few clicks, you can broadcast your game session, from Origin, directly to your Twitch account," Twitch told us on their blog. This will be very beneficial to gamers who want to share their gameplay.

To simply start broadcasting, jump into a game and bring up the Origin screen. A camera has been added as an option on the bottom of the screen.

If you don't have Twitch you will be asked to create an account. If you already have an account go ahead and sign in.

Once you have signed in you should be introduced with a lot of option. These options included will be game volume, naming your stream, and allowing you to commence or stop the stream.

While you’re streaming, a broadcast indicator will show up on the top of your screen to let you know how many people are watching your broadcast, and how long you’ve been streaming."

Added on to all this neat stuff is that you will be allowed to add games to your My Game library that you have purchased outside of Origin.
